How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 46288?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
46288 Studio Apartments | $1,336 | $595 | $2,877 |
46288 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,467 | $699 | $4,071 |
46288 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,942 | $820 | $5,706 |
46288 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,093 | $1,285 | $5,590 |
46288 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,146 | $550 | $3,496 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included the 46288 ZIP Code Apartments
What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in 46288?
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in 46288 is at The Factory (new) listed at $500.
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included 46288 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in 46288 is $1,080.
What is the largest Utilities Included 46288 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in 46288 is a 1,695 square feet unit starting from $500 at The Factory (new).
What is the average size for 46288 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in 46288 is currently at 819 sq ft.
